VERONA, N.I.. (Novembro. 4, 2019) — Two of the light heavyweight’s division’s most explosive fighters are set for a fistic shootout Saturday, Jan. 18, as former world champion Eleider “Storm” Alvarez will face Michael “Cannon Handz” Seals at Turning Stone Resort Casino.


The 10-round showdown will be contested for the vacant WBC Continental Americas title, and the winner is expected to challenge for a world title in 2020.

Alvarez (24-1, 12 KOs), the Colombian-born, Montreal-based boxer-puncher has not fought since Feb. 2, when he dropped a unanimous decision to Sergey Kovalev six months after knocking him out to win the WBO light heavyweight world title. Alvarez’s long layoff is due to a torn foot ligament he suffered in training earlier this year. He hopes a win over Seals will earn him another crack at world championship glory.

Seals (24-2, 18 KOs), a Mobile, Alabama, native who played collegiate football at Alabama A&M, is still one of the division’s heaviest hitters at 37 anos de idade. An 11-year pro, Seals has been involved in many memorable brawls, incluindo um 2015 Fight of the Year contender versus Edwin Rodriguez that included five knockdowns in three rounds. Despite falling short versus Rodriguez, Seals’ reputation as a fan-friendly was solidified. Ele ganhou quatro em uma fileira, including three by knockout in either first or second round. He is coming off a one-punch, first-round knockout Oct. 18 in Philadelphia against Elio Trosch.

CO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. (Novembro 4, 2019) – Olympic gold-medalists“Big” George ForemanMark Breland e“Smokin’” Joe Frazier head the Class of 2019 into the USA Boxing Alumni Association Hall of Fame, noite de sexta-feira, Dezembro 13, at Golden Nugget Hotel & Casino em Lake Charles, Louisiana.

A recepção HOF está a ser realizada em conjunto com o 2020 Olympic Trials and 2019 Campeonatos Nacionais. Dezembro. 7-15, em Lake Charles Civic Center. The finals Olympic Trials will be held Sunday, Dezembro. 15, no Golden Nugget Hotel & Casino em Lake Charles, Louisiana. Hall of Fame emissoraAl Bernstein da Showtime Sports vai servir como mestre de cerimônias do evento pelo terceiro ano consecutivo.

USA Boxing Alumni Association’s third class also includes decorated coachesAl MitchelleRay Rodgers

sua. John McCain will be posthumously presented a special Lifetime Achievement Award. A fearless boxer for three years at the U.S. Academia Naval, sua. McCain managed his battalion’s boxing team to the brigade championship.

sua. McCain was the architect of the ground-breaking Muhammad Ali Act, pushed for the pardoning ofJack Johnson, and worked with the Cleveland Clinic on the forefront of brain trauma studies leading to more safety measures for boxers.

Capataz (para: 76-5, 68 KOs, amador: 22-4) was also a three-time World Heavyweight Champion as a pro, in addition to famously winning a gold medal at the 1968 Olympics in Mexico, as well as at the National AAU Championships. A resident of Houston, Texas, his victims included Frazier (duas vezes), Ken NortonDwight Muhammad Qawi eMichael Moorer.

Considered one of the greatest amateur boxers of all-time, Breland (para: 35-3-1, 25 KOs), amador: 110-1) era um medalhista de ouro no 1984 Olympic Games in Las Angeles and 1982 World Championships. The Brooklyn native was a two-time World Welterweight Champion as a pro. His most notable victories were versusSteve LittleRafael Pineda eLloyd Honeyghan.

The late Frazier (para: 32-4-1, 27 KOs, amador: 38-2), representing Philadelphia, captured a gold medal at the 1964 Olympics in Japan and he was a three-time World Heavyweight Champion as a professional. Frazier’s hit list includedMuhammad AliJimmy Ellis (duas vezes),Bob Foster eOscar Bonavena (duas vezes).

Mitchell has been in boxing for more than 60 anos, first as a boxer, but he’s much better known as a world-class boxing coach. He has been the boxing coach at N. Universidade de Michigan por décadas, além de ser treinador principal da 1996 U.S. Equipe Olímpica, e consultor técnico para o 2004 e 2012 U.S. esquadrões Olímpicos. Ele foi selecionado como o 1994 EUA treinador de boxe do Ano e entre os campeões 800-plus nacionais amadores ele tem trabalhado com sãoMike TysonFloyd Mayweather eVernon Forrest.  Ele atualmente treina 2016 U.S. contendor olímpico e título mundialMikaela Mayer, que estarão presentes apoiando seu treinador.

A lenda em Arkansas boxe, Rodgers tem sido um treinador excepcional e cut-homem extraordinário, que esteve no canto de campeões mundiais, comoWayne McCulloughJermain TaylorIran Barkley eTommy Morrison.  décadas de Ray de serviço através de treinamento e orientação para a juventude de Arkansas já estabeleceu-o como um modelo e inspiração para treinadores de boxe amador em todos os lugares.

Nikolai Potapov Returns with Impressive TKO over Africa’s Nasibu Ramadhani

WBO #9 e IBF #11 Bantamweight Nikolai Potapov returned to action Thursday night in Moscow with an impressive fifth-round TKO over Tanzanian veteran Nasibu Ramadhani.


Fighting in the 10-round main event of a card presented by Shamo Boxing at the Korston Club Hotel, Potapov (21-2-1, 12 KOs), de Podolsk, Rússia, worked past a head-butt induced cut left eye to put his world-class skills on full display. He wobbled the aggressive Ramadhani (29-14-2, 16 KOs) in the second round with a three-punch combination and continued to dominate until the stoppage.


“I am glad to get the work and the win,” said the victorious Potapov. “I would like to come back to the US and get another opportunity to fight for the world title.”


The fight was Potapov’s first since his highly controversial decision loss to fellow contender Joshua Greer last July. Promotor de Potapov, Dmitriy Salita, says the capable Russian is gearing up for another assault on the division’s best.

DEVIN HANEY FACES SANTIAGO IN MAIDEN WORLD TITLE DEFENSE

‘The DreamMeets Unbeaten Dominican Challenger in Los Angeles on Nov 9



LAS VEGAS, NV (Novembro 2, 2019)Devin Haney will face Alfredo Santiago in the first defense of his WBC World Lightweight title at STAPLES Center in Los Angeles on Saturday November 9, live on DAZN in the US, Sky Sports in the UK and distributed globally on FITE.

TICKETS FOR KSI-LOGAN PAUL II FEATURING HANEY-SANTIAGO ARE ON SALE NOW – CLIQUE AQUI

Haney (23-0 15 KOs) was elevated to full champion at the recent WBC Convention in Cancun, México, following his dominant performance against Zaur Abdullaev in New York in September where he overpowered the unbeaten Russian over four blistering rounds to force Abdullaev to retire, and land ‘The Dreamthe interim belt at 135lbs.

Now Haney makes the short trip from his Las Vegas home to Los Angeles where he faces Santiago (12-0 4 KOs) in his maiden defence, the unbeaten Dominican talent, que transforma 25 the day after the fight, will be on looking to derail Haney’s reign as champion at the first hurdle.

22-Brooklyn de um ano, N.I.. nativo e 2016 Olímpico Richardson Hitchins (10-0, 5 KOs) fez sua televisão e ShoBox estreia na luta conjunta, vencendo uma decisão unânime sobre Kevin Johnson (7-2, 4 KOs). Os juízes marcou a luta 96-94 e 97-93 duas vezes.



Hitchins, que representou o país natal de seus pais, o Haiti, no 2016 Jogos do rio, usou sua habilidade, velocidade e defesa para derrotar Johnson de 27 anos. Hitchins foi ligeiramente melhor em cada categoria, rodada após rodada, permitindo-lhe construir pistas pequenas, mas decisivas, a caminho da decisão unânime. Johnson era um pouco mais ativo (52.6 para 49.8 socos por rodada) mas Hitchins era mais preciso e o perfurador de corpo mais robusto. Hitchins pousou em 30 por cento de seus golpes de energia, enquanto Johnson pousou apenas 19 por cento do seu, e Hitchins conectado em 46 fotos do corpo em comparação com 30 para johnson.

Em uma revanche muito esperada entre dois lutadores com história e sangue ruim, Kevin Newman II (11-1-1, 6 KOs) vingou a única perda de sua carreira, dominando Marcos Hernandez (14-3-1, 3 KOs) com uma decisão quase unânime de fechamento. Os juízes marcou a luta 80-72 e 79-73 duas vezes.



Completando a distância completa de oito rounds pela primeira vez em sua carreira, Newman, que é treinado pelo ex-campeão mundial Bones Adams, dominou a segunda metade da luta. Ele desembarcou 82 Total de socos 46 contra nas rodadas cinco a oito e foi capaz de estabelecer um ataque letal que destruiu o Hernandez de Sacramento, conectando em 79 fotos do corpo em comparação com apenas 10 para Hernandez. Newman também liderou 152-97 em socos gerais acertou e 114-57 em tiros poderosos, enquanto quase correspondia a Hernandez em socos dados (399 para 435).

LaTavia Roberson Signs First Fighter Fernando Bunch

PARA DIVULGAÇÃO IMEDIATA


HOUSTON, TX–Roberson Sports Management is proud to announce the signing of it’s first fighter, undefeated lightweight Fernando Bunch.


Roberson Sports Management is owned by LaTavia Roberson who is best known as an original member of the R&B group Destiny’s Child, one of the world’s
best-selling groups of all time.

Nine-Time World Champion Roy Jones Jr. is training Fernando Bunch. LaTavia wanted to get a fighter signed, and her team started looking. Since LaTavia owns Slugfest Magazine, and had done a cover story with Roy earlier in the year. Her partner Alfred Adams, Vice President of Roberson Sports Management, asked Roy if he knew of any up and coming prospects. Roy said he had someone LaTavia should look at. Adams immediately took notice of Bunch’s speed and strength.

Fernando Bunch was born Fernando Parks, but in 2010 he and his father decided he should take his father’s last name, and he changed it. Fernando was born in Birmingham, Alabama, e é 27 anos. He stands 5’11 and campaigns at 130lbs.-135lbs. He is the youngest of 5 irmãos. He has about 120 lutas amadoras em seu currículo. Both of his parents are God fearing and was raised in the Mount Calvary Baptist Church. Fernando graduated from
Hephzibah High School in 2009 at the top of his class. As of now, he works as a Tech Support specialist at T-Mobile for the last 5 anos. Ele tem 2 daughters, a 7-year-old daughter named Mya Armani and an 8-month-old daughter name Miliana Pelea. They are both his pride & joy and his reason why he strives so hard to be successful in his boxing career and in life.

Fernando started boxing in 2001, in which was a transition from Taekwondo due to disqualifications for obsessive use of punches. Basicamente, he quit because he was more interested in punching than kicking. Throughout his early years of boxing he won State and Regional Junior Olympics, Silver Gloves, Luvas de Ouro, and competed in the National Golden Gloves, Augusta National Ringside Classics, Title National Paul Murphy, and USA
Championships. He also fought in the 2015 Olympic Trials in Colorado Springs, as well in Philadelphia. In the midst of all those tournaments, his coach left for 2 & 1/2 tours in Iraq. Consequently, his trainer’s absence caused him to miss a lot of opportunities to take part in many national tournaments. Fernando received experience within his amateur boxing career by training with world champions such as the Erislandy Lara and the Charlo Brothers, but he also learned from greats such as Ronnie Shields, Paul Williams and now with his head coach the Great Roy Jones Jr.

Fernando has the potential to have a tremendous professional boxing career. He is always willing to learn, and strongly believes in the sayingThe day you stop learning, is the day you stop getting better.As of right now, Fernando is 9-0 as a professional with 5 Knockouts and trains with Roy Jones Jr in Pensacola, FL.

BOSTON, Massa. (Outubro 28, 2019) – United States Military Academy Senior Cadet Luca LoConte Botis, who was born and raised in Winchester (De Massa.,) is looking forward to his final local boxing competition on Sunday, Novembro 10.

Botis, captain of the West Point boxing team, will be in action in front of many friends and family members Nov. 10 at the National Collegiate Boxing Association’s (NCBA) “West Point Fall Classic,” to be held at Anthony’s in nearby Malden, Massachusetts.

Members of the West Point boxing team will compete against amateur boxers from USA Boxing New England, University of Connecticut, Trinity College, Hartford College, and the University of Massachusetts.
Botis is a 2015 graduate of Winchester High School, where he captained the school’s cross country, swimming and outdoor track teams.

It always feels nice to comeback home and fight in front of my home crowd,” Botis said. “Since this is the last local fight for me, I can definitely say there is an early sense of nostalgia.

Botis will graduate from the United States Military Academy on May 23, 2020, after which he will be commissioned as a Second Lieutenant in the U.S. Exército. Although he hopes to serve in the Infantry in either Colorado or Kentucky, Botis will not know his first assignment until Nov. 13, nor where he will be assigned until February.

Boxing has been an enjoyable experience for Botis for numerous reasons. “Boxing has helped me become a more humble, respectful person,” he explained. “In the boxing ring there must be mutual respect between the two opponents; no taunting, teasing, or any form of disrespect. Boxers must also learn to not feel emotional toward their opponents. I learned these lessons by fighting in or watching fights where instances as such occurred.

I will not be boxing competitive in the army, but I will continue to train, because it is the best form of exercise I have ever experienced. Regarding my post-Army life, I will most likely volunteer at local gyms to train the younger generations to box.

Unsure how long he will serve in the U.S. Exército, at least at this stage, Botis plans to serve more than his required five years, but less than 10 anos. He speaks an incredible seven languages: Inglês, Italian, Sicilian and Romanian he learned at home, adding Portuguese, Spanish and a little Hebrew at West Point.

Botis has somewhat followed the path set by his great uncle, Louis LoConte, who was a varsity athlete excelling in hockey. He graduated in 1948 with honors from West Point, where he was trained to fly B-52 bombers. The now 93 anos, who lives in Louisiana, served in the military until 1956. Lucas’ grande, great grandfather, Louis LoConte, Sr., immigrated to the U.S. from Sicily, working as mason on the West Point military base. He used to speak to his son, Lou, about how much he admired young Cadets, understanding that they were special.
